Portable Automation Training Solution Aims to Close Skills Gap for the Digital Industrial Workforce

Emerson today introduced the Performance Learning Platform, a portable and compact automation technology training solution to help close the workforce skills gap by enabling hands-on training that will prepare workers to maintain their plant safely and efficiently. The platform introduces and reinforces the competencies essential for fostering digital transformation as the Industrial IoT (Internet of Things) era continues to change the way manufacturing and process companies do business.

The Performance Learning Platform can increase learning for a new generation of workers to become adept at applying, using and maintaining the latest digital automation technologies. It provides process control and instrumentation to train or refresh current workers on instruments used to monitor and control industrial processes including pressure, flow, level and final control valves.

Colleges can also benefit from the platform to give students firsthand experience on an actual plant-like process. The Performance Learning Platform features a complete working control loop piping system, tanks, pumps and a fully-scalable suite of Emerson instrumentation and final control valves linked to a DeltaVTM distributed control system. Each unit ships with an integrated video library that provides step-by-step instruction in a range of realistic scenarios, allowing users to learn and experiment without the expense and risks of on-the-job training. A lab workbook and supporting eLearning courses are also available.

Built on a robust steel frame with casters and able to fit through most standard-size doors while occupying only a small area, the platform is plug and play. It requires only water, compressed air, and power to operate, making it practical for on-site training or classroom use.
